Locking Wheel Nut Keys

The locking wheel nuts are a simple but effective deterrent for criminals trying to steal the wheels of your car. They're just like regular lug nuts, but with a cut-out in the middle to ensure that they can only be undone with the matching key. They are also designed to be much harder to remove than standard lug nuts which can be a deterrent to thieves.

The locking nuts have a hexagonal end on one side and a cylindrical end on the other. They are exclusive to the set that came with your car therefore you must verify first. They are usually stored for safe keeping within the boot (if your car has a spare wheel) or in the glove box with your car ownership manual.

Other places to check are the pockets for cards on the door or the storage compartments in the centre console - they may have gotten there after your vehicle changed hands a few times. If you're lucky your lock nut key should still be in its container in the cabin. If not, a new key will need to be ordered, and could take a lengthy time to arrive. Transponder Keys

Since their introduction in 1995 transponder keys have become an integral part of numerous vehicles. These keys are equipped with a tiny electronic chip that transmits an unique identification signal to the engine control unit. When the key is put in the ignition the ECU recognizes the transponder's identification and turns on the engine. The key is also more difficult to duplicate than conventional keys, which makes it a great choice for people who want to keep their cars secure.

Transponders are constructed of sturdy materials, which means they are able to withstand a lot of wear and tear. The chips are also resistant to temperature fluctuations, so they are less likely to fail. These features make the keys more durable and cost-effective than other keys.

Remote Keys

A remote key, also known as a "smart key" is designed to make it easier to lock and unlock your vehicle without having to insert your keyblade made of metal. It is powered by a tiny battery and features buttons that you can use to switch on the ignition. A chip within the head of the remote key communicates with your car's ignition to start it.

It is easy to replace a dead battery in the event that your remote isn't working. Make sure that all buttons are activated, and that the metal clips are properly inserted to ensure that the circuit is working.

Water damage is another common reason for the Citroen C1 remote key not working. Even a short bath in a basin full of soapy water or a submersion in the pool or ocean can be a serious threat to the electronics of your key fob particularly the electronic chip within. It is recommended to remove the fob's key and dry it with a paper towel before replacing it.

A malfunctioning receiver may stop your Citroen's C1 remote key from working. You can try rebooting the system by disconnecting the battery at 12 volts for a few minutes. This will draw out any remaining power and reset all the computer systems onboard.
